Martin Louis GRAHAM was born 21 May 1893 in Dudley, Massachusetts, USA

Martin Louis GRAHAM was the child of Martin GRAHAM   and   Annie Mary CURWIN and the grandchild of: (maternal)  James CURWIN and Catherine HOEY

Martin Louis was a soldier in World War I.

Tracing Ancestors Through Military Service Records: Unveiling Family Heroes


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Martin Louis  married  Alice G WALSH abt. 1920 in Dudley, Massachusetts, USA .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Alice G WALSH  was born 8 February 1897 in Dudley, Massachusetts, USA.  Alice G died 13 March 1988 in Webster, Massachusetts, USA.  Alice G was the child of Edward Joseph WALSH and Ella "Ellen" Ernestine BERGMANN.

Martin Louis GRAHAM died 28 October 1963 in Webster, Massachusetts, USA.

1940 Webster, Worcester, Massachusetts
291 High Street
Graham Martin, head, 46, b. MA, percher, woolen mill, $1160
Graham Alice, wife, 43, b. MA, mender, woolen mill, $475
Graham Robert, son, 17, b. MA, janitor helpler, N. Y. A. work, $30
Welch Ellen, mother-in-law, 71, widowed, b. MA

News1962 - The Cuban Missile Crisis was a tense 13-day standoff in October 1962 between the United States and the Soviet Union over the installation of Soviet nuclear missiles in Cuba, just 90 miles from the U.S. coast. The crisis is considered the closest the Cold War came to escalating into a full-scale nuclear war. It began when American spy planes discovered the missiles, leading to a U.S. naval blockade of Cuba and intense negotiations. The crisis ended when Soviet Premier Nikita Khrushchev agreed to remove the missiles in exchange for the U.S. promising not to invade Cuba and secretly agreeing to remove American missiles from Turkey.
